The marking of the Statehood Day

The wreath laying and candle lighting ceremony in the Mirogoj Cemetery in Zagreb by the President of the Republic of Croatia as Supreme Commander of the Croatian Armed Forces, Kolinda Grabar-Kitarović, the Croatian Prime Minister Andrej Plenković and the Speaker of the Croatian Parliament Gordan Jandroković, the delegation of the Ministry of Defence and of the Croatian Armed Forces, headed by the Deputy Prime Minister and Defence Minister Damir Krstičević

and the Chief of the General Staff of the Croatian Armed Forces, General Mirko Šundov and other delegations  opened the marking of the Statehood Day of the Republic of Croatia and the 26th anniversary of the declaration of independence and sovereignty of the Republic of Croatia.
The wreaths were laid at the Monument of the Voice of Croatian Victims – Wall of Pain

 Monument the Voice of the Croatian Victims – Wall of Pain, the Central Cross in the Alley of the  Fallen Croatian Defenders, the tomb of the first Croatian President dr. Franjo Tuđman and in the Common Grave of the Unidentified Victirms of the Homeland War at the Crematory. 
In the Zagreb Cathedral the Archbishop of Zagreb, Cardinal Josip Bozanić celebrated the Mass for the Homeland.
The marking of the Statehood Day was concluded with the reception in the Office of the President of the Republic.
